This feels not-quite-fully-developed... close but not there yet.
Graphics fine, gameplay smooth... but something is missing. Simple things, like opting for a "first to 10" or "first to 20" or "endless play" game. This would add much more tension to the game - there's very little tension if the scores go on endlessly.
Perhaps a limit on the number of times a player can hit the ball before getting it over the net (it's boring watching the computer play keepy-uppy with it).
Don't let the ball come to rest on the net. Or give it a timer, so that if it gets stuck, it blows up, to the penalty of whichever player failed to get it over, or perhaps hit it last (in the case of a player bouncing it straight off their opponent's wall).
Maybe give the computer easy, medium and hard modes - that shouldn't be too hard to do, simply restricting his speed ought to be enough.
This is very close to being an excellent little game. As it is it's a fun timewaster but it seems a bit of a waste, for all the effort that went into the gameplay and graphics, not to have taken the game design a bit further.
